Mater Christi College is an independent Catholic secondary school for girls in Years 7-12, founded in 1961 by the Marist Sisters in Belgrave Heights, Victoria. Nestled in the Dandenong Ranges, the school spans a 22-hectare campus that promotes a nurturing environment focused on academic rigor, spiritual growth, and personal development. Key achievements include consistent high VCE results, strong extracurricular programs in performing arts and sports, and a commitment to social justice initiatives. The mission, inspired by Mary, emphasizes empowering young women to become compassionate leaders. With around 800 students, the college offers a range of subjects from humanities to sciences, alongside innovative programs like the Marist Leadership Initiative.

Teacher salaries at Mater Christi College follow the Victorian Catholic systemic schools' enterprise agreement, offering competitive pay in the private sector. Entry-level graduates earn around AUD $78,000, while experienced teachers with 10+ years can reach AUD $110,000+, plus allowances for overload or leadership. Factors like subject specialization (e.g., higher for STEM), qualifications, and location in regional Victoria influence pay. Compared to public schools, private Catholic institutions like Mater Christi provide similar base rates but better super contributions. ? The curriculum at Mater Christi College blends Victorian Curriculum standards with Catholic values, offering major subjects like Advanced Mathematics, Environmental Science, Visual Arts, and Languages (French, Italian). Innovations include digital integration via tools like Education Perfect and a focus on sustainability through the Eco-Warriors program. Extracurriculars encompass debating, music ensembles, and overseas immersion trips. Collaborations with local TAFE for vocational pathways enhance opportunities.
